• 服务实体经济质效提升 银行业助力中国经济高质量发展
  • 政务平台:功能比形式更重要
  • 班戈谐钦舞从草原来,出了草原惊艳了世界
  • 云南税务:优化服务促改革 齐心协力再推进
  • 唐卡艺术高端论坛将在京举行
  • ::紫光阁::中共中央国家机关工作委员会
  • 广东自贸区率先建立全球质量溯源体系 将向13个APEC成员推广
  • 名爵HS正式上市 2种动力9款车型售价11.98万起
  • 湖州:全力打造“市监铁军” 争做“四新”主题实践排头兵
  • 三菱将主攻插电式混动车 排除纯电动SUV可能
  • 渤海银行杭州分行积极开展2018年“普及金融知识,守住‘钱袋子’”系列活动
  • 金沙江堰塞湖抢险电力保障有序推进
  • 言恭达:人文艺术以清雅为上、神逸难得
  • 我们该如何跟孩子谈性?性教育女讲师的酸甜苦辣
  • 罗永浩:子弹短信不是为挑战微信 腾讯还想来投资
  • 丰城问政网

    2018年Linux云计算+运维开发课程大纲

    丰城问政网 www.dgsuoyi.com 目前课程版本:2.0   升级时间:2018.09.01   查看详细

    Linux云计算+运维开发基础班课程大纲

    学习对象

    0基础0经验的小白人员;想通过自己的努力,成为一名高级Linux运维工程师的转型人员。

    上课方式

    全日制脱产,每周5天上课(实际培训时间可能因法定节假日等因素发生变化)

    培训时间

    部分校区可能会根据实际情况有所调整,详情可询咨询老师   点击咨询


    培训要求

    自带笔记本

     

    Linux云计算+运维开发基本班课程大纲
    所处阶段主讲内容技术要点学习目标
    第一阶段:
    运维基本功
    运维基础运维发展史、计算机概述,硬件组成,软件应用,操作系统学完此阶段可掌握的核心能力:
    熟练掌握Linux操作系统的安装、配置、相关指令、VIM编辑器、LAMP环境配置以及开源项目实战。

    学完此阶段可解决的现实问题:
    能够根据企业实际项目需求实现服务器部署与架构。

    学完此阶段可拥有的市场价值:
    熟练掌握之后,可以满足市场对初级运维工程师的需求,但是市场就业工资相对较低,还是建议继续学习就业班课程。
    Linux系统概述Linux系统概述,虚拟机,CentOS x64系统安装,CentOS系统配置、基本的Linux指令
    Linux系统安装
    Linux基本指令
    VIM编辑器VIM编辑器介绍,三种模式(命令模式,输入模式,末行模式),相关VIM指令,VIM项目实战
    Linux用户权限用户和组概念,用户和组相关操作,Linux用户权限配置,企业实际案例应用
    Linux系统机制系统模式、用户操作、网络配置、SSH、FQDN、chkconfig、ntp、防火墙、RPM包、定时任务
    LAMP环境配置+开源项目实战(YUM)LAMP环境概述、LAMP环境编译安装、YUM指令、YUM指令配置LAMP环境、开源项目实战

    Linux云计算+运维开发就业班课程大纲

    学习对象

    0基础0经验的小白人员;想通过自己的努力,成为一名网络安全+运维工程师的转型人员。

    上课方式

    培训时间及周期:全日制脱产,每周5天上课(实际培训时间可能因法定节假日等因素发生变化)

    培训时间

    部分校区可能会根据实际情况有所调整,详情可询咨询老师   点击咨询


     

    Linux云计算+运维开发就业班课程大纲
    所处阶段主讲内容技术要点学习目标
    第二阶段:
    运维进阶
    网络基础网络概念、IP、网卡、网线、交换机、路由器、局部网、广域网、网络应用实战学完此阶段课掌握的核心能力:
    1、了解Linux系统运行原理,实现Linux服务器的维护与管理;
    2、了解Linux系统相关服务,能根据企业需求实现企业运维工作。

    学完此阶段可解决的现实问题:
    能实现企业Linux服务器的日常维护与管理,搭建SSH、FTP、DNS、Apache等服务、能独立完成系统日志分析、数据库DBA等相关工作。

    学完此阶段可拥有的市场价值:
    熟练学习和掌握后,可满足企业运维的初中级需求,根据市场反馈数据看,薪资普遍在 5000元/月以上。
    Linux高级指令Linux基本指令回顾、Linux高级指令详解
    Linux下软件包的管理Linux软件包概述、Linux下常见软件包管理
    Linux分区+LVM逻辑卷添加新硬盘、fdisk指令概述、Linux分区概述、Linux分区实战、几个基本概念(PV、VG、PE、LV)、LVM操作实战
    RaidRaid概述、基本原理、关键技术、Raid等级、Raid应用选择
    sshd服务sshd服务概述,yum源配置,sshd服务安装与配置实战,公私钥概念,ssh免密码登录
    文件共享服务(ftp/nfs/samba)ftp服务概述,ftp安装与配置实战,nfs服务概述,nfs安装与配置实战,samba服务概述,samba安装与配置实战
    DNS域名服务DNS概述、DNS详解、DNS域名服务实战
    LAMP环境(apache)网站访问流程、服务程序介绍(Apache、Nginx、IIS、Tomcat)、阿里云产品介绍、LAMP服务器构建
    rsyslog日志概念与应用场景、日志的种类、日志查看的相关指令、rsyslog介绍、实践部署
    MySQLMySQL概述,MySQL安装,MySQL配置,MySQL基本操作、MySQL索引、MySQL备份与还原、MySQL主从复制、MySQL读写分离、MySQL企业级应用实战
    第三阶段:
    运维脚本开发
    Shell编程Shell概述、变量、Shell流程控制、Shell数组、Shell函数、Shell特殊用法、正则表达式、Shell编程实战学完此阶段可掌握的核心能力:
    1、掌握Shell/Python脚本基本语法;
    2、建立起编程思维和面向对象思想;
    3、掌握复杂Shell脚本开发;
    4、掌握Python运维相关???。

    学完此阶段可解决的现实问题:
    1、具备一定的编程思维;
    2、能够熟练编写复杂Shell脚本;
    3、能够熟练掌握Python运维相关??槭迪衷宋芾?。

    学完此阶段可拥有的市场价值:
    熟练掌握和学习后,可满足Linux运维开发行业的中级需求,薪资普遍8000+元/月。
    Python运维基础Python概述、注释、变量、流程结构、字符串、函数、面向对象编程、异常、运维开发???、Python编程实战
    第四阶段:
    运维线上实战
    之运维10年发展
    与架构实战
    Nginx部署Nginx概述、编译安装概述、Nginx服务器部署、Nginx配置文件详解学完此阶段可掌握的核心能力:
    1、 具备Linux服务器架构设计能力,保证应用架构合理可控;
    2、具备解决复杂问题和技术难点的能力。

    学完此阶段可解决的现实问题:
    1、掌握Java、PHP服务器架构能力;
    2、能够独立搭建企业级高可用服务器(集群、高可用、负载均衡、缓存、存储);
    3、掌握阿里云/华为云产品实战。

    学完此阶段可拥有的市场价值:
    熟练掌握和学习后,可满足Linux运维行业中高级需求,根据市场反馈数据看,薪资普遍在 10000元/月以上。
    LNMP企业架构回顾LAMP、编译安装概述、下载NMP软件安装包、Nginx+PHP+MySQL编译安装、LNMP环境部署、企业级商城系统部署测试
    MySQL单点服务器部署MySQL数据库回顾、企业级商城系统MySQL数据库部署
    KeepAlive/HA
    高可用服务器集群架构
    Keepalived概述、VRRP协议、VRRP工作机制、VRRP工作流程、环境配置、高可用服务器集群构建
    LB(Haproxy/Nginx/LVS)
    负载均衡服务器架构
    LB负载均衡概述、Haproxy/Nginx/LVS服务器架构
    MySQL读写分离
    (程序开发角度)
    商城系统MySQL数据库读写分离实战
    NoSQL
    (Memcache/Redis/MongoDB)
    NoSQL概述、Memcache概述、Memcache服务器架构、key-value数据类型、缓存应用实战;Redis概述,Redis服务器架构、Redis支持的数据类型、持久化功能、Redis主从模式、Redis集群;MongoDB概述、MongoDB进阶、MongoDB的权限机制、MongoDB集群
    存储(NAS/SAN)存储概述、NAS/SAN的区别与应用
    终极项目:企业级服务架构实战企业级商城系统架构设计与实战
    TomcatTomcat概述、Tomcat服务器安装与部署、Nginx+Tomcat集群架构、JavaWeb实战
    第五阶段:
    运维线下实战
    之运维自动化
    监控(Zabbix/普罗米修斯)监控概述、Zabbix企业级监控部署实战、扩展:普罗米修斯监控学完此阶段可掌握的核心能力:
    1、具备监控检查系统软硬件运行状态,保证系统安全稳定运行的能力;
    2、具备CI/CD持续集成/持续支付能力;
    3、具备配置自动化以及日志分析能力。

    学完此阶段可解决的现实问题:
    1、能使用Zabbix/普罗米修斯搭建企业级监控;
    2、能够熟练掌握CI/CD持续集成/持续支付工具;
    3、能够使用Ansible/SaltStack实现运维自动化;
    4、能使用ELK实现企业级日志分析。

    学完此阶段可拥有的市场价值:
    熟练掌握和学习后,可满足Linux运维行业的高级需求,薪资普遍12000+元/月。
    CI/CD(Git、Gitlab、Jenkins)版本控制软件概述,Git/SVN概述,Git/SVN服务器构建,Git/SVN客户端使用,图标集,版本冲突,版本回退,授权机制,钩子程序,Jekins+Maven+Git/SVN实现持续集成
    配置自动化(Ansible/SaltStack)Ansible/Saltstack概述,Master与Minion认证,Master与Minion连接,Python与Python???,Ansible/SaltStack安装与配置
    日志分析(ELK)ELK概述,ELK架构图、ELK安装与部署、插件安装、LogStash的安装与使用、Kibana的安装及使用、ELK实战
    第六阶段:
    运维调优+安全
    应用软件调优(Web应用调优)常用应用软件概述、Nginx/Tomcat应用调优学完此阶段课掌握的核心能力:
    1、了解常见的几种调优方式
    2、深入了解网络相关知识;
    3、掌握常用的攻击防护手段;
    4、掌握主流的云安全产品。

    学完此阶段可解决的现实问题:
    1、能根据常见服务器性能问题,提出针对性的调优解决方案;
    2、了解常用的网络设备以及云安全产品,具备一定安全防护能力;
    3、具备安全防护意识,防患未然。

    学完此阶段可拥有的市场价值:
    真正掌握并具备运维调优+运维安全防护能力,可胜任安全运维工程师的相关工作,市场薪资普遍在 14000元/月以上。
    内核参数调优内核参数详解、内核调优实战
    系统调优系统调优分析、系统调优实战
    运维安全(防火墙/CA认证/VPN)Linux系统安全概述,防火墙的分类,防火墙的工作原理,iptables概述,iptables企业运维实战、CA认证、VPN概述、OpenVPN Server架设、IPsec VPN 隧道、VPN实战
    第七阶段:
    运维云计算
    Hadoop大数据概念概述,Hadoop+HDFS大数据服务器架构, wordcount入门,MR编程实例,Python脚本编程实战学完此阶段可掌握的核心能力:
    1、熟练掌握虚拟化技术;
    2、掌握公有云与私有云架构实战;
    3、熟练使用容器与容器编排工具;
    4、熟练掌握大数据服务器架构。

    学完此阶段可解决的现实问题:
    1、能够使用KVM实现虚拟化;
    2、能够熟练使用Docker容器;
    3、能够熟练使用Kubernates容器编排工具;
    4、能够掌握公有云与私有云服务器架构实战;
    5、能够独立构建Hadoop大数据服务器。

    学完此阶段可拥有的市场价值:
    熟练掌握和学习后,可满足Linux云计算架构工程师的高级需求,薪资普遍18000+元/月。
    虚拟化(KVM)虚拟化技术概述,Xen、VMware、KVM虚拟化对比与实践
    公有云运维(阿里云)公有云概述、阿里云/华为云应用实战
    私有云运维(OpenStack/ESXi)Openstack概述,OpenStack组件功能介绍,OpenStack安装与配置,OpenStack私有云运维实战; ESXi私有云运维实战
    容器Docker+监控Docker概述,Docker部署,Docker容器,Docker镜像仓库、Docker实战
    容器编排工具(Kubernates)Kubernetes概述、Kubernetes安装与部署、Docker+Kubernetes集群实战
    第八阶段:
    Python运维开发
    HTML5HTML简介、HTML标签详解、字符编码的奥秘、HTML5新特性与常用标签学完此阶段可掌握的核心能力:
    1、掌握Web前端开发相关技术如HTML5/CSS3/JavaScript;
    2、掌握Python运维相关???;
    3、掌握Python Django框架;
    4、具备一定的Python运维开发能力。

    学完此阶段可解决的现实问题:
    1、具备一定的编程思维,为未来系统架构师铺路搭桥;
    2、能够熟练掌握Python运维相关??槭迪衷宋芾?;
    3、能够使用Python+Django开发企业自动化运维平台。

    学完此阶段可拥有的市场价值:
    熟练掌握和学习后,可满足Linux运维行业的高级需求,薪资普遍25000+元/月。
    CSS3CSS简介、CSS的引入方式、CSS基本选择器、CSS属性、盒子模型、CSS浮动、CSS3新特性与常用属性、CSS应用案例
    JavaScriptJavaScript概述、Javascript注意点、直接量、数据类型、流程控制、数组、函数、字符串、BOM模型、DOM模型、jQuery框架实战
    Python运维项目开发Python+Django开发企业自动化运维平台

    基础差? 可免费学基础班

    申请试读名额

    基础过关? 可直接就读就业班

    基础测试

    Linux云计算+运维开发学科项目介绍

    • DEDECMS旅游网站

      项目简介:

      LAMP(Linux操作系统+Apache服务器+MySQL数据库+PHP编程语言)网站架构是目前服务器中非常流行的一种架构,其架构无论在性能、质量还是价格等方面都是企业搭建网站的首选平台。本项目将结合基本班的相关内容带领学员一步一步完成LAMP环境部署并实现开源项目的构建(博客系统、商城系统、门户网站、ThinkPHP项目等)

      项目特色:

      1、 LAMP环境介绍
      2、编译安装Apache
      3、编译安装MySQL
      编译安装PHP
      5、YUM指令介绍
      6、YUM指令实现LAMP环境部署
      7、开源项目实战

    • PXE Menu

      项目简介:

      PXE(preboot execute environment,预启动执行环境)是由Intel公司开发的最新技术,工作于Client/Server的网络模式,支持工作站通过网络从远端服务器下载映像,并由此支持通过网络启动操作系统,在启动过程中,终端要求服务器分配IP地址,再用TFTP(trivial file transfer protocol)或MTFTP(multicast trivial file transfer protocol)协议下载一个启动软件包到本机内存中执行,由这个启动软件包完成终端(客户端)基本软件设置,从而引导预先安装在服务器中的终端操作系统。

      项目特色:

      1、PXE工作模式
      2、DHCP服务
      3、DNS服务
      4、TFTP服务
      5、FTP服务
      6、PXE企业装机实战

    • OneAPM性能调优

      项目简介:

      本课程阶段为网络安全+运维工程师的核心阶段,项目较多,主要包括高级运维架构图解、ELK日志分析、Git版本控制软件、(Cacti、Zabbix数据监控等等)、OneAPM服务器性能调优、阿里云产品实战等等。通过此阶段的学习,可以让学员在实战中学习到真正核心的运维技术,从而可以让学员针对企业运维中的实际问题提出针对性的解决方案,成为运维方面的专家。

      项目特色:

      1、JAVA、PHP环境部署调优
      2、服务器集群
      3、高性能、高可用服务器架构
      4、Zabbix、Cacti服务器性能监控
      5、ELK日志分析
      6、初级运维自动化Salt Puppet
      7、OneAPM服务器性能调优
      8、阿里云产品实战

    • Redis监控(redis-monitor)

      项目简介:

      数据库管理员(Database Administrator,简称DBA),是从事管理和维护数据库管理系统(DBMS)的相关工作人员的统称,属于运维工程师的一个分支,主要负责业务数据库从设计、测试到部署交付的全生命周期管理。DBA的核心目标是保证数据库管理系统的稳定性、安全性、完整性和高性能。本阶段项目课程学习将带领学员从数据库初识到数据库DBA,真正成长为一名合格的DBA工程师。

      项目特色:

      1、MySQL基础与高级查询
      2、MySQL权限管理
      3、MySQL数据库管理工具
      4、MySQL优化
      5、数据库中间件(MyCAT,altas,Amoeba)
      6、NoSQL数据库技术(Memcache、Redis、MongoDB)
      7、超大型数据库项目案例实战

    • AWK

      项目简介:

      Shell脚本语言是实现Linux/UNIX系统管理及自动化运维所必备的重要工具,Linux/UNIX系统的底层及基础应用软件的核心大都设计Shell脚本的内容。每个合格的Linux系统管理员或运维工程师,都需要能够熟练地编写Shell脚本语言,不能够阅读系统及各类软件附带的Shell脚本内容。
      本阶段项目将通过Shell脚本语言结合SED、AWK、GREP指令实现日志文件操作以及Shell脚本语言结合Zabbix实现服务器监控系统。

      项目特色:

      1、Shell编程进阶
      2、Shell核心应用
      3、正则表达式
      4、SED、AWK、GREP
      5、Shell实战(Zabbix扩展-Shell监控)

    • Docker

      项目简介:

      本阶段项目主要为BAT等超大型公司提供专业的运维解决方案,项目内容主要包括:虚拟化技术、SaltStack自动化、Openstack自动化运维、Docker实战、jenkins+maven、Hadoop云计算、DevOps、企业级项目实战

      项目特色:

      1、虚拟化技术
      2、SaltStack自动化运维
      3、Openstack自动化运维
      4、Docker实战
      5、jenkins+maven
      6、Hadoop云计算
      7、DevOps

    • Python自动化

      项目简介:

      Python是一种面向对象的解释型计算机程序设计语言,其具有丰富和强大的库。它常被称为胶水语言,能够把用其他语言制作的各种??楹芮崴傻亓嵩谝黄?,在企业运维自动化中起着非常重要的作用。
      本项目将通过Python结合运维技术,为企业架设提供自动化、智能化的运维管理平台,如jumpserver跳板机、分布式监控系统、任务调度系统等等。

      项目特色:

      1、Python环境配置
      2、Python语法
      3、运维自动化???br>4、自动化运维工具实战

    教学服务

    • 每日测评

      每晚对学员当天知识的吸收程度、老师授课内容难易程度进行评分,老师会根据学员反馈进行分析,对学员吸收情况调整授课内容、课程节奏,最终让每位学员都可以跟上班级学习的整体节奏。

    • 技术辅导

      为每个就业班都安排了一名优秀的技术指导老师,不管是白天还是晚自习时间,随时解答学员问题,进一步巩固和加强课上知识。

    • 学习系统

      为了能辅助学员掌握所学知识,黑马程序员自主研发了6大学习系统,包括教学反馈系统、学习难易和吸收分析系统、学习测试系统、在线作业系统、学习任务手册、学员综合能力评定分析等。

    • 末位辅导

      末位辅导队列的学员,将会得到重点关心。技术辅导老师会在学员休息时间,针对学员的疑惑进行知识点梳理、答疑、辅导。以确保知识点掌握上没有一个学员掉队,真正落实不抛弃,不放弃任何一个学员。

    • 生活关怀

      从学员学习中的心态调整,到生活中的困难协助,从课上班级氛围塑造到课下多彩的班级活动,班主任360度暖心鼓励相伴。

    • 就业辅导

      小到五险一金的解释、面试礼仪的培训;大到500强企业面试实训及如何针对性地制定复习计划,帮助学员拿到高薪Offer。